  • Bank Of America Cashpay Card

    ;If you have a Bank of America CashPay Card, whether it is a Visa or Mastercard, you can transfer funds to your bank account. If you have an originally-issued CashPay card, it is possible to perform an online funds transfer to a traditional United States savings or checking account that you own.

    You have to pay corresponding fees and a minimum of $20 may be transferred.

  • Go to the CashPay Customer Service website;www.bankofamerica.com/cashpay.
  • Register a transfer-to account before performing your first transfer. You can only have up to two transfer-to accounts in your profile.
  • After registration, you can sign in and select the Transfer funds link within your online Account Summary page.
  • It takes 5 business days for your new transfer-to account to be authenticated before the transfer will be made.

    Paying Bills With Prepaid Cards

    There are two types of prepaid payment cards that can potentially be used to pay bills: prepaid debit cards and network-branded gift cards . Prepaid debit cards come in a few different forms and offer the opportunity for a convenient money storage account that can take the place of complex checking. Gift cards that carry the Visa or Mastercard logo are typically sold in different denominations and can be used for online shopping or bill payment if sufficient balances are available.

    Before diving into bill payments, it can be good to understand the two types of prepaid payment card options a little better. Prepaid debit cards can work like network-branded;gift cards and any electronic payment card that is loaded with funds considered deposit assets rather than credit liabilities. As the market for prepaid debit expands, more and more, consumers are gaining access to a simplified electronic money storage solutions that can take the place of traditional bank checking.

    How Do Gift Cards Work

    A gift card resembles a credit or debit card since it is plastic in nature. They have specific numbers that identify the cards. Anybody can use it since most do not link to a particular person.

    Most cards have no PIN, and if you lose one, it is the same as losing real money. Someone else can use it if they collect it. However, Visa and Mastercard gift cards have been using PIN since 2013.

    Some gift cards are only useful for one-time payments, while others are reloadable. Reloadable cards are almost similar to prepaid debit cards and can allow you to transfer money using the routing number and account number to a bank account. This means that you do not have to lock yourself to buy goods only.;

    When buying goods with you, the merchants use the on-line electronic system for authorization to deduct the amount you have spent when shopping. These include a serial number, barcode, or magnetic strip. While some gift cards will only allow you to buy at specific stores, cards from banks allow you to purchase from any store that accepts them.

    For instance,;Giftcards;issues Visa and MasterCard that can be used anywhere that accepts Visa and Mastercard.

    Before being sold, most gift cards have no value. When buying, the seller now loads money on the cards depending on the amount you pay. However, some cards have a set value, and once you receive them, you have to call a given number to activate them.

    Why Is My Vanilla Gift Card Being Declined

    Visa gift cards are linked to bank accounts that generally must be activated in order to receive transactions. Inactive cards will be declined if used for payment because the associated bank accounts are not ready to be used. When the gift card is loaded with value , the gift card is automatically activated.

    Convert Your Visa Gift Card To Cash By Selling It To A Website

    There are plenty of websites that will pay cash for your Visa gift card. In addition to the ones mentioned above that have apps for this, there are also others like Gift Card Granny, CardCash and more.

    If your gift card is digital, then the process can be instantaneous. But even if you have a physical card, some of these sites will pay for your postage to send them the card, so you wont end up losing any money on that front.

    Like with the apps, the sites will take a fee based on a percentage of the balance of the card, so make sure you know just how much this is before agreeing to the sale.

    Also, it can be a good idea to do some searches for the site youre considering using, just to get the most up to date reviews on whether other people have had a good experience with them.

    Can I sell a Visa gift card to other people?

    You can definitely sell a Visa gift card to other people, but youre probably going to have to accept less money than the balance on the card to make it worth their while to buy it from you.

    Sites like eBay or Craigslist will work perfectly for these kinds of arrangements. Make sure you keep in mind shipping costs if youre selling a physical card and, as always on these kinds of sites, keep an eye out for any scams. If something sounds too good to be true, it probably is.

    How Do I Use My Gift Card

    There are two types of gift cards offered by banks, and these are open-loop and closed-loop. Financial institutions issue the first one, and you can use it to buy goods at any place accepting the cards. The second one can only be used with a specific merchant. For example, you can have a gift card that can only be used with Walmart or Amazon.

    When you want to buy items with your card, you visit a store accepting the cards and then use a gift card reader machine to communicate with the card issuer, allowing a specific value deduction.

    One time gift cards are useless once their value is exhausted. However, reloadable cards allow you to top up money when the balance is low. Banks and other financial institutions usually offer reloadable cards with no fees so that you do not have to buy cards now and then.

    While there are tangible gift cards, there are also mobile gift delivered to mobile phones via email or SMS. You can use them online with social apps instead of queuing in stores. Visa virtual cards are useful anywhere in the world.

    Sell It To A Gift Card Exchange Website

    Using a gift card exchange website, like Gift Card Granny or CardCash, is the most straightforward method for converting your gift cards into cold hard cash. All you have to do is go on their website and sell your gift card.

    Both Gift Card Granny and CardCash take a wide variety of gift cards, including Visa ones. You can easily trade Visa gift cards for cash payments. The best part is they offer up to 90% cashback during the entire process.

    First, youll need to select an offer. Once you choose the Visa gift card with an appropriate balance, you can submit it and go through a verification process.

    After this is done, youll be able to get paid. This online method allows you to earn more money compared to more expensive rates of gift card kiosks. Keep in mind it might not work for every Visa gift card, as offers come and go.

    Can you sell a Visa gift card to another person?

    Yes, you can sell your Visa gift card to another individual without it affecting the gift card. If you go this route, youll likely find that people will only be interested in buying it from you if its offered at a discount.

    Otherwise, they could avoid the hassle by buying a gift card from a regular retailer. This is a valid option though if you can sell it for more money than a gift card exchange offers you.
